WebApr 3, 2024 · 1. Acorns (Best for Using Round-Ups to Invest) Acorns is an investing app geared toward minors, young adults, and millennials, that pioneered round-up capabilities. Acorns’ Round-Ups feature rounds up purchases made on linked debit and credit cards to the nearest dollar, investing the difference on your behalf.
